Output 53c5a38b789168fe39e93290e07c03f3f8d941babebf0db4a034554e9ace47f7:3

value
436589
script pubkey
OP_0 OP_PUSHBYTES_20 e96cc30a53d3f2892a1d8d688c132255ec2fdfd1
address
bc1qa9kvxzjn60egj2sa345gcyez2hkzlh73y3whrh
transaction
53c5a38b789168fe39e93290e07c03f3f8d941babebf0db4a034554e9ace47f7
spent
true